With Google Contacts, even if they all get deleted Google has the ability to restore your contacts intact, to as they were at any point in the last 30 days.

Unfortunately, no such ability exists for Google Calendars. Deleted Calendars cannot be restored. However, you can get your deleted event information back so you can re-create your Calendars. Go here for instructions:
